
Cerny’s impressive performance this season, including 12 goals across competitions, has heightened interest from clubs like Villarreal and West Ham. Despite Cerny’s satisfaction at Rangers, financial constraints make a permanent move unlikely.
Additionally, several Rangers players are anticipated to depart Ibrox:
- James Tavernier: The captain’s omission from a Europa League match has fueled speculation about his future, with pundits suggesting this could be his final season at Rangers.
- Kieran Dowell: Limited playing time has led to talks of a loan move to Birmingham City, as the midfielder seeks more opportunities.
- Rabbi Matondo: Persistent links to EFL Championship clubs, coupled with injury setbacks, suggest a potential departure in the upcoming transfer window.
These developments indicate a period of transition for Rangers, with significant changes expected in the squad composition.
